Prior Employment: 

Private practice, Boston, Massachusetts, 1966-1968
Assistant attorney general and chief trial attorney, Consumer Protection and Antitrust Division, State of Washington, 1968-1977
Adjunct professor, University of Washington Law School, 1975-1977
Judge, Superior Court of the State of Washington, King County, 1977-1980
Director, Federal Judicial Center, 2003-2011
